Seven killed in Pakistan violence


Islamabad, May 20 (IANS): At least seven people were killed Tuesday in different parts of Pakistan, media reported.

Two men and a priest of a Lahore mosque were shot dead by unidentified gunmen, The News International reported.

In another incident, three bodies were recovered in Orangi Town near Karachi, an official said. 

A woman was also gunned down in Lyari, the official added.
